The study of taxation often wrestles with a fundamental question: can cutting taxes ever increase government revenue? The relationship between tax rates and revenue is not always straightforward. The Laffer Curve provides a theoretical framework to explore this paradox, illustrating that revenue collection may collapse at both extremely low and extremely high tax levels, peaking at an intermediate point.
Understanding this model can empower policymakers to seek an optimal point where revenue peaks, balancing the dual aims of funding public services and maintaining economic vitality.
Originally sketched on a napkin and widely credited to economist Arthur Laffer in the early 1970s, the curve has since sparked decades of debate, experimentation, and controversy. By charting the incentives that drive economic incentives and taxable activity, it reveals surprising dynamics that still resonate in modern fiscal discussions.
Long before Arthur Laffer’s famous drawing, the idea that excessive taxation could stifle productivity appeared in the writings of 14th-century scholar Ibn Khaldun. His observations anticipated the notion that beyond a certain threshold, higher levies would erode the very base from which governments collect revenue.
In 1974, amidst a political environment dominated by Keynesian calls for higher taxes to spur government spending, Laffer presented a simple two-axis curve to illustrate how cutting rates above the peak could actually boost receipts. This sketch became a powerful pedagogical tool in supply-side circles and reshaped debates about tax policy in the United States and beyond.
At its core, the Laffer Curve combines two basic effects: the arithmetic effect of the tax rate and the economic response of taxpayers.
As the tax rate (t) climbs from zero, revenue initially rises because of the arithmetic boost. But past a turning point—often called T*—the negative economic reactions dominate. Workers may reduce hours, investors may seek shelters, and evasion can surge, driving revenues down despite higher nominal rates.
The precise shape of the curve depends heavily on the role of taxable income elasticity: how sensitive reported income is to changes in tax rates. When elasticity is high, even small rate hikes can cause large base contractions, shifting the peak to the left.
Locating the peak of the Laffer Curve in real economies remains a challenging empirical puzzle. Estimates vary significantly according to methodology, the measure of the tax base, and the extent of underground economic activity.

The supply-side interpretation of the curve advocates tax cuts as a mechanism to expand economic activity and revenues. Proponents argue that trimming rates spurs investment, creation of jobs, and overall growth, leading governments to recoup otherwise lost revenue.
Critics counter that most modern economies operate well below the prohibitive range, meaning rate cuts often require spending cuts or additional borrowing to balance budgets. The Reagan administrations of the 1980s provide a cautionary tale: despite significant tax reductions, deficits ballooned by roughly $2 trillion, raising questions about the curve’s predictive power.
Today’s debates consider not just marginal rates but also progressivity, capital gains levies, and the size of the informal sector. Some scholars argue that in generous welfare states, even modest rates may fall into the curve’s prohibitive limb, while others warn that celebrated anecdotes overlook long-term fiscal sustainability.
Visually, the Laffer Curve is elegant in its simplicity: a parabolic arc that rises from the origin, peaks, and descends to the horizontal axis at a 100% rate. Variations layer on additional curves to represent different elasticities or segmentations by income bracket.
Equally powerful is the story of the original napkin sketch—a reminder that transformative ideas need not emerge from elaborate models, but often from clear, concise representation of complex dynamics.
While the model does not prescribe specific rates, it offers a lens to evaluate tax policy trade-offs. By acknowledging the tension between raising revenue and preserving incentives, governments can craft more balanced systems.
Ultimately, the Laffer Curve is not a formula to be blindly applied but a guide encouraging deeper analysis of taxpayer behavior, economic context, and the true costs of taxation. When used judiciously, it can illuminate pathways to more efficient, equitable, and sustainable fiscal outcomes.
